My wrenches must be magical because every time one of them touches my bike something breaks or something disappears! Now admittedly, I have zero experience working on bikes but it seems the most basic of maintenance tasks always turns into a magic act of some sort. Take yesterdays show for example. I wanted to change my newly aquired bikes oil from black to amber. In the process I figured I would also change my oil filter. Glad I did because it looked as though this had not been successfully accomplished before. As it turns out to get to the oil filter I had to remove the exhaust headers because of someones lame decision to put these four into one exhaust on my bike that seem to drag on every right turn. All went well until I wrenched off the final bolt while reinstalling the headers. Thats when it occurred to me. I think my wrench made the collars for the exhaust disappear. There are flanges on there but all of the flanges seem to be bent convex and the bolts seem to bottom out before completely securing the header.
Should there be collars of some sort on there?
I'm pretty confident I can remove the bolt but I can't find anywhere on the forum or in my manual what the size of the bolts are so I can replace them.
I know this information is somewhere on the forums but I have exhausted my computer time for today looking for it so please someone what size are those bolts and am I missing the collars? It's a 1978 GS 1000.
